Caroling from the very beginning actually had nothing to do with Christmas. As a word with a definition meaning “to dance to something”, carols were originally celebratory songs from pagan festivals. People would have celebrations where they would sing and dance at the time of the change for all four seasons.

4: Joy To The World. They say a good tune lasts forever, and that rings true for this enduring entry among the best Christmas carols. Written way back in 1719, Joy To The World has the distinction of being the most-published Christian hymn in North America. Being a Ghost Story of Christmas, commonly known as A Christmas Carol, is a novella by Charles Dickens, first published in London by Chapman & Hall in 1843 and illustrated by John Leech. It recounts the story of Ebenezer Scrooge, an elderly miser who is visited by the ghost of his former business partner Jacob ...

A carol revival began in the second half of the 18th century. The best Christmas hymns of the era, e.g., Charles Wesley’s “Hark, the herald angels sing,” still lack the distinctive carol touch. The revival built on collections of traditional broadsides, which included “The first Nowell,” and “A Virgin Most Pure.”. Brief history of Christmas carols. A Christmas carol is a traditional Christmas song with lyrics that often holds a religious message. The word carol can be derived from a similar french word, carole (some say the Latin carula ), describing the phenomenon to dance in a circle.
